Helen Skelton praised on ITV Lorraine after 'rough time'

As Summer on the Farm returns to our screens tonight, July 7, presenter Helen Skelton was praised on looking 'well' and 'happy' as she appeared on ITV Lorraine.

Helen Skelton appeared on Monday's episode of ITV Lorraine where Lorraine Kelly complimented her saying, "I'm glad to see you look well and happy, you are a woman after my own heart," after her public split from husband, Richie Myler.

Helen announced on April 25 that the pair, who had been married for eight years, were no longer together. In an emotional Instagram post, the 38-year-old TV star said that Richie had "left the family home".

Just weeks after the split it emerged that Myler was in a new relationship with girlfriend Stephanie Thirkill.

In Monday's episode of ITV Lorraine, Helen appeared to discuss Summer on the Farm which will return to screens from 8pm this evening. Lorraine Kelly said: "Its so good to see you, you have had a rough time I know - its good to get out there working.

Helen, 38, will present Summer on the Farm 2022 (@helenskelton/Instagram)

"You are my kind of woman, you put on a brave face."

Helen told Lorraine: "Anyone in my position would do the same.

"Its so much fun, it's not like work - I talk out loud and play with cute animals."

Although this series will be very different from Christmas on the Farm, because Helen was pregnant, she gave birth to a daughter named Elsie Kate, just four months before the split from former husband.

She added: "There was always a vet on hand when filming, imagine if the baby was delivered by a vet."

After taking a break from work and social media following the split. Helen has since returned to our screens and has a 'world opening up for her' as she takes on new presenting roles. The TV star has previously been a sports presenter at the start of her career - she will be doing more for Five Live in the coming weeks.

She will also be coming to ITV for 'something secret' in September, Lorraine teased.
